"The lawsuit, which will be made public on Monday, contains the first seven wrongful death claims filed against Norfolk Southern railroad. It alleges that the railroad and its contractors failed to properly clean up the toxic chemicals released during the derailment, and that officials at the EPA and CDC signed off on the cleanup without warning residents about the health risks. The lawsuit also claims that the railroad's greed is to blame for the derailment and that the $600 million class-action settlement does not offer enough compensation or accountability."
